- Define Your Scope: What problem are you trying to solve? Who is your target audience? What features will your app offer? Begin by clearly defining the goals and the needs of your project. Specify the functionalities and the main features you want to incorporate into the application. Consider the user experience (UX) and how users will interact with the app.
- Gather Data: Identify and collect the financial data you need. This may involve using financial APIs, web scraping, or accessing internal datasets. The accuracy and relevance of your data will directly impact the reliability of your app. Consider the format, frequency, and source of your data to ensure its quality.
- Data Preprocessing: Clean, transform, and prepare the data for analysis. This includes handling missing values, standardizing data formats, and feature engineering. Data preprocessing is crucial for the reliability and accuracy of your analysis.
- Develop Data Models: Implement the financial models and analytical techniques. This might involve building machine learning models, creating financial calculations, or developing data visualizations. Use the relevant data analysis and statistical techniques that align with the goals of the project.
- Design the UI/UX: Create an intuitive and user-friendly interface. Design the layout, navigation, and user interaction. The design should be appealing and easy to navigate, providing users with a seamless and enjoyable experience.
- Develop iOS App: Write the code using Swift or Objective-C in Xcode. Build the app features, integrate the data models, and connect to data sources. Consider incorporating user authentication, data storage, and API integration.
- Testing: Thoroughly test your app on various iOS devices. Ensure it performs as expected and that the data is accurate. Testing is essential to identify and fix bugs and ensure a seamless experience for users.
- Deployment: Publish your app on the App Store to make it available to users. Prepare the necessary documentation and app store assets. Carefully prepare the app for public use to ensure it meets all required standards.
- Maintenance: Provide ongoing maintenance, updates, and improvements. Monitor user feedback, fix bugs, and add new features. Maintenance ensures the long-term success of the app.
Hey everyone! Ever thought about how iOS data science is changing the game in finance? It's not just about crunching numbers anymore, guys. We're talking about real-time insights, smarter decisions, and a whole new way to look at money. This is where the magic of combining iOS development with cutting-edge data science comes in. In this article, we'll dive deep into how an iOS data science project can transform the finance industry. We'll explore the tools, techniques, and potential of this exciting field.
The Power of iOS in Financial Data Science
Let's get real, folks. iOS devices are everywhere. They're in our pockets, on our desks, and even in the hands of some of the most influential people in finance. So, imagine the potential of leveraging this widespread accessibility to create powerful financial tools. iOS data science projects allow us to bring sophisticated analytics right to the user's fingertips. This means instant access to market trends, investment recommendations, and personalized financial advice. This transformation is about more than just convenience. It's about empowering individuals and professionals alike to make informed decisions, stay ahead of the curve, and ultimately, achieve their financial goals. With the right iOS data science project, you can provide users with interactive dashboards, real-time data visualizations, and predictive analytics models, all within a user-friendly iOS environment. Developing these apps requires a blend of skills, including iOS development expertise (think Swift or Objective-C), data science knowledge (Python, R, etc.), and a solid understanding of financial principles. By mastering these areas, you can create innovative solutions that revolutionize how people interact with finance.
Think about it: financial institutions can build mobile apps that provide clients with personalized investment portfolios, risk assessments, and real-time market updates. Fintech startups can create apps that offer budgeting tools, expense tracking, and automated savings plans. And even individual investors can use these tools to make smarter decisions about their money. The possibilities are truly endless, and the benefits are enormous. One of the primary advantages of iOS data science in finance is the ability to analyze massive datasets in real time. This capability allows us to identify patterns, predict trends, and make data-driven decisions that can significantly improve financial outcomes. For example, machine learning algorithms can be trained on historical market data to forecast future price movements, enabling traders to make more informed investment choices. Furthermore, iOS data science can be used to detect fraudulent activities, assess credit risk, and personalize financial products and services. The ability to tailor financial offerings to individual needs is crucial in today's competitive market, and iOS apps provide the perfect platform for delivering such personalized experiences. In essence, by embracing iOS and data science, financial institutions can unlock a new level of efficiency, accuracy, and customer engagement.
Key Components of an iOS Data Science Finance Project
Okay, so you're excited about building an iOS data science finance project? Awesome! Let's break down the essential components. First, you'll need a solid understanding of iOS development. This includes proficiency in Swift or Objective-C, knowledge of iOS frameworks, and experience with user interface design. Creating a seamless and intuitive user experience is critical for any successful app, so don't skimp on this part. Secondly, you'll need a strong foundation in data science. This includes familiarity with programming languages like Python or R, experience with data analysis and machine learning techniques, and a solid understanding of statistical concepts. You'll be working with large datasets, so knowing how to clean, process, and analyze this data is a must. Thirdly, you'll need to understand financial principles and concepts. This includes knowledge of financial markets, investment strategies, risk management, and regulatory compliance. You can't build a useful financial app without a firm grasp of the underlying financial concepts.
Another crucial aspect is choosing the right data sources. You'll need access to reliable and up-to-date financial data, which can come from various sources, such as financial APIs (e.g., Yahoo Finance, IEX Cloud), market data providers (e.g., Bloomberg, Refinitiv), or internal datasets. The quality and availability of your data will directly impact the accuracy and effectiveness of your project. Next, focus on the data processing and analysis. This involves cleaning, transforming, and analyzing the data to extract meaningful insights. Use appropriate data visualization techniques to present your findings in a clear and understandable format. Consider building machine learning models to predict trends, identify patterns, and automate decision-making processes. Finally, user interface (UI) and user experience (UX) are essential. Design an intuitive and user-friendly interface that allows users to easily access and understand the information provided by your app. Make sure your app is visually appealing and easy to navigate. Consider the user's needs and preferences when designing the UI/UX. The user experience is essential for a good iOS data science finance project, as it's the gateway through which users interact with your data and insights.
Tools and Technologies for Your Project
Alright, let's talk about the tools of the trade. For iOS development, you'll definitely need Xcode, Apple's integrated development environment (IDE). Xcode provides everything you need to build, test, and debug your iOS app. As for programming languages, Swift is the modern choice and the preferred language for iOS development, but Objective-C is still used for older projects. For data science and analysis, Python is your best friend. Libraries like NumPy, Pandas, and scikit-learn are essential for data manipulation, analysis, and machine learning. You can also use R, another popular language for statistical computing and data analysis.
For data visualization, consider using libraries like Matplotlib, Seaborn, or Plotly in Python. These libraries allow you to create stunning and informative charts and graphs that can help you communicate your findings effectively. If you want to integrate machine learning models into your app, you can use libraries like TensorFlow or PyTorch. These powerful frameworks allow you to build and deploy sophisticated machine-learning models that can analyze data and make predictions. Also, think about cloud services for data storage, processing, and deployment. Services like AWS, Google Cloud, and Azure offer various tools and services that can help you manage and scale your project. They provide scalable computing resources, data storage, and machine-learning services. Additionally, you will need to choose the appropriate data sources and APIs to access financial data. Financial APIs from providers like Yahoo Finance, IEX Cloud, or Bloomberg can be valuable resources. These APIs provide real-time and historical financial data, which is essential for any finance project. Finally, you can use frameworks and libraries that will improve the UI/UX, like SwiftUI, which is a powerful framework for building modern and intuitive user interfaces. By using these tools, you can create a powerful and visually appealing application that empowers users with financial insights.
Building a Financial App: A Step-by-Step Guide
Let's get practical, shall we? Here's a simplified guide to building your iOS data science finance app.
Real-World Applications and Examples
Time for some real-world inspiration, folks! Let's look at how iOS data science is already making waves in the finance world. Firstly, Personal Finance Apps. These apps use data science to track expenses, create budgets, and offer personalized financial advice. Imagine an app that analyzes your spending habits and suggests ways to save money, all within a sleek iOS interface. Secondly, Investment Platforms. Many investment platforms now offer iOS apps that use data science to provide users with investment recommendations, portfolio analysis, and market insights. These apps use machine learning to analyze market data and provide users with actionable investment advice. Thirdly, Fraud Detection Systems. Financial institutions are leveraging iOS data science to develop fraud detection systems that can identify and prevent fraudulent transactions in real time. These systems analyze transaction data to identify patterns and anomalies that indicate fraudulent activities.
Also, think about Risk Assessment Tools. These tools use data science to assess financial risk, such as credit risk, market risk, and operational risk. Data scientists develop models that assess the financial risk of individuals or businesses. Plus, we've got Algorithmic Trading Platforms. These platforms use data science to automate trading strategies and make real-time trading decisions. Algorithmic trading platforms use data science to analyze market data, identify trends, and automate trading decisions. One such example is the use of apps that analyze market data, and then offer actionable trading advice. These apps have a user-friendly interface which makes it easy for the users to understand and act. Another example is the use of data science to personalize financial advice. These platforms analyze a user's financial profile and then provide personalized recommendations. These recommendations can include investment options, savings strategies, and other financial advice tailored to individual needs. The power of iOS data science is truly transforming the financial landscape. By combining the power of iOS development with the insights from data science, we can create more efficient, user-friendly, and effective financial solutions.
Challenges and Future Trends
Alright, let's keep it real – it's not all smooth sailing. Developing iOS data science finance projects comes with its challenges. Data privacy and security are paramount. You're dealing with sensitive financial information, so you need to implement robust security measures to protect user data. Staying compliant with financial regulations (like GDPR and CCPA) is another biggie. The regulations are complex and vary by region, so it's essential to understand and comply with all the applicable regulations. Integrating with legacy systems can be tricky. Many financial institutions still use older systems, and integrating your iOS app with these systems can be complex.
Data quality and reliability are critical. The quality and accuracy of the data you use will directly affect the accuracy of your results. Continuous data quality monitoring is essential. Keeping up with the latest technologies is challenging. The field of data science is constantly evolving. Staying current with the latest trends and technologies is vital for maintaining a competitive edge. The field of data science is continually evolving, and it is crucial to stay current with the latest techniques and trends. Additionally, you will face user experience complexities. Creating an intuitive and user-friendly user experience that allows users to easily understand and use your app can be a challenge. With that in mind, let's peek into the future. The rise of artificial intelligence (AI) and machine learning (ML) will continue to transform the finance industry. Expect to see more AI-powered financial tools that can automate tasks, make predictions, and provide personalized financial advice. The integration of blockchain technology and decentralized finance (DeFi) will also present exciting opportunities. Blockchain has the potential to revolutionize financial transactions. In addition, the use of augmented reality (AR) and virtual reality (VR) in financial applications will become more prevalent. AR and VR technologies have the potential to change the way people interact with financial data and services. In addition, the demand for personalized financial solutions will increase. Users will expect financial solutions that are tailored to their individual needs and goals. Furthermore, the use of natural language processing (NLP) will increase. NLP will enable more natural and intuitive interactions with financial applications. Staying ahead of these trends will be key to success in the world of iOS data science in finance.
Conclusion
So, there you have it, folks! An iOS data science finance project can be a game-changer. From personalized financial advice to fraud detection, the possibilities are endless. If you're passionate about finance and technology, this is an area you definitely want to explore. Embrace the power of iOS data science, and start building the future of finance today! By combining the user-friendliness of iOS with the power of data science, you can create innovative financial solutions that will transform how people interact with finance.
Lastest News
-
-
Related News
MGM Vs. Borgata: Which Atlantic City Casino Reigns Supreme?
Jhon Lennon - Nov 17, 2025 59 Views -
Related News
Egypt's World Cup Journey: Triumphs And Challenges
Jhon Lennon - Oct 29, 2025 50 Views -
Related News
Airbus A380: A British Airways Icon
Jhon Lennon - Oct 23, 2025 35 Views -
Related News
Fast Track No Aeroporto Do Porto: Guia Completo E Dicas
Jhon Lennon - Nov 17, 2025 55 Views -
Related News
PSEITEXASSE Floods: Live Updates And Impact
Jhon Lennon - Nov 16, 2025 43 Views